Mohan Babu films thrilling action scene for Gayatri

Mohan Babu has filmed a thrilling action sequence for Gayatri according to the film's action choreographer.  

“It was an absolute joy to direct an obsessive artist like him and see him perform,” Kanal Kannan, the film’s action director, said in a statement. The actor performed the stunt rig action sequence with style, and a lot of planning and practice was involved in order to minimise the risks, he added.

Nero Motion control rig is being used for adding visual effects in Gayatri, in which Mohan Babu plays the hero as well as the villain. According to the statement, the film’s makers had especially flown in a stunt rig from Australia, coupled with a well-planned stunt design and stunt co-ordinators, to create a unique visual spectacle for the fight scene. The fight sequence is being shot for the last eight days and will continue for another three days.

Vishnu Manchu also features in Gayatri as a romantic character opposite Shriya Saran. The film will get released on February 9.
